Caledonia Recruitment are currently assisting a fantastic Logistics company to recruit a Road Freight Operator with strong experience in the freight forwarding industry.
Role Description
This is a full-time on-site role as a Road Freight Operator located in the Denny area. The Coordinator will be responsible for coordinating various import and export road transportation to ensure efficient and timely delivery of goods. Tasks include managing schedules, communicating with customers , tracking shipments, and resolving transportation issues.

Qualifications
- Experience in logistics, transportation, or supply chain management
- Experience in the transportation of drinks/alcohol
- Knowledge of road import and export transportation and processes
- Strong organizational and communication skills
- Ability to work in a fast-paced environment and multitask effectively
- Proficiency in data analysis and reporting
- Attention to detail and problem-solving abilities
- Experience with transportation management systems is a plus
- Bachelor\’s degree in Logistics, Supply Chain Management, or related field
